# Intel is set to join Elon Musk’s Terrafab project, an all-new AI chip manufacturing complex being developed in Texas with SpaceX and Tesla.

*semiconductor · news · 2026-04-08 · Firstpost*

## Key points

- Intel has officially joined Elon Musk's Terrafab AI chip manufacturing project in Texas.
- Terrafab aims to produce 1 terawatt per year of compute for AI and robotics applications.
- Two advanced chip plants are planned in Austin: one for electric cars and robots, another for space-based AI data centers.
- Intel has secured several billion dollars in funding from Nvidia and the U.S. government, now its largest shareholder.
- Terrafab will target 2-nanometer process chips, including A15, A16, and D3 chips for robots and satellites.
